Gourmet Yellow Mustard

This recipe makes two cups of mustard (using a whole 3 OZ jar of mustard seed), but you can halve the recipe to make only one cup. Ingredients
-
½ cup regenerative yellow mustard seeds (90 g or a whole jar)
-
1 ¼ cups water (310 ml)
-
4 tbsp white wine vinegar (60 ml)
-
1 tsp salt
-
½ tsp onion powder
-
½ tsp turmeric
-
¼ tsp paprika
Directions
In a bowl, combine the mustard seeds, ¾ cup (180 ml) of the water, 2 tbsp (30 ml) of the vinegar and ½ teaspoon of the salt. Mix to combine. Cover and let marinate for 24 hours at room temperature.
Drain the mustard seeds 24 hours later and put them into a blender. Add the remaining water, vinegar, salt, and spices. Puree until emulsified and as smooth as possible. Add more water 1 tbsp at a time if needed until it reaches your desired consistency.
Transfer the mustard into a 2-cup (500 ml) glass jar. Tightly seal and refrigerate for 7 days. The flavor of the mustard will continue to develop over this period. The mustard will keep for 6 months in the refrigerator.
Recipe Note
- You could eat the mustard right away, however we seal and refrigerate it to develop that flavor that you will love! So it is worth the wait!
- You can adjust the consistency to your liking - we enjoy it a little less smooth then typical American mustard but you can make it however you want!
